    • The present invention provides a method for cleaning a photo mask without the need for removal of the pellicle mounted on the photo mask, without the large scale equipment for washing with a solution, with a small number of steps for cleaning and inspection, and without the increase of the production cost. The method for cleaning a photo mask with a pellicle mounted, in which the pellicle frame has a gas introducing hole and a gas discharging hole, comprises: a step of introducing a gaseous substituting substance from the gas introducing hole in a pellicle inner space surrounded by the photo mask and the pellicle, substituting foreign substances on the photo mask, and discharging the foreign substances from the gas discharging hole; and a step of irradiating an ultraviolet ray to the photo mask, while an air or a nitrogen gas or a rare gas is introduced from the gas introducing hole, for degrading the substituted substituting substance so as to be gaseous, and discharging the same from the gas discharging hole.

    • A mower unit is disclosed, including a mower deck mounting therein in parallel layout first, second and third rotary blades rotatably driven about vertical axes and a washing device. The mower deck includes a top wall, side walls and first, second and third auxiliary side walls for evacuation, the auxiliary side walls having shapes along at least a machine body rear portion of the rotary path of each rotary blade. The washing device includes a single water supplying unit disposed upwardly of the top wall for supplying washing water and first, second and third water discharging units disposed through the first, second and third auxiliary side walls for discharging water to the first, second and third rotary blades respectively. The washing device includes also a water supplying pipe unit interconnecting and communicating the water supplying unit to the first, second and third water discharging units. The water supplying pipe unit is disposed within a mower deck rear space delimited by outer faces of the first, second and third auxiliary side walls. The first, second and third water discharging units are configured to discharge the washing water in such a manner that the center flow portion of the discharged water respectively therefrom is confined within the inner space of the mower deck.
